Reports To: Facilities Manager
General Summary: Under the direction of the Facilities Manager, is responsible for providing a variety of janitorial services for Assumption Catholic School.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
- Supports the School's spiritual and pastoral mission
- Follows a cleaning schedule to assure the School buildings are cleaned and maintained in an orderly fashion
- Performs general custodial duties to include cleaning and light maintenance of the School facilities.
- Performs scheduled monthly, semi-annual, or annual janitorial duties, i.e., floor waxing, painting, window washing, carpet cleaning, etc. as directed and in accordance with the School's custodial and maintenance schedule
- Provides set-up and cleaning of facilities for all activities and events as directed
- Cleans equipment, including kitchen, restrooms and other facilities; recommends and request replacement of equipment and notifies maintenance of issues as necessary
- Maintains a supply of cleaning supplies and equipment in all maintenance closets; properly account for materials and equipment
- Maintains security of buildings, equipment, and tools
- Complies with safety regulations as required; maintain a safe working environment
- Performs other duties as assigned.
